1 change control
"Principles and processes that facilitate the management of change without compromising the quality or integrity of an IT project or solution, through structured procedures for submitting, approving, implementing, and reviewing change requests." -
2 change type attribute
"An attribute applicable to text file and database management agents that denotes the type of change (that is, add, modify, or delete) to be made to a connector space object." -
3 change management
The practice of administering changes with the help of tested methods and techniques in order to avoid new errors and minimize the impact of changes. -
4 configuration management
"The process of identifying and defining configuration items in a system, recording and reporting the status of configuration items and requests for change, and verifying the completeness and correctness of configuration items." -
5 disk configuration information
